Highly Sensitive Person therapists in Midland, Texas Statistics

Highly Sensitive Person therapists in Midland, Texas average 17 years of experience and charge around $186 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(47%), Person-Centered Therapy (Rogerian) (47%), and Psychoeducational Therapy (42%).
